AHR Expo wows attendees

AHR Expo product eye candy from a contractor’s point of view.
Dave Yates
Dave Yates
March 4, 2024

The AHR Expo was held in Chicago's McCormick Convention Center from Jan. 22-24, 2024. Over 48,000 attendees interacted with 1,875 exhibitors across the North and South Halls, with 527,520 sq. ft. of space for products, technologies, and skill demonstrations.

Does the boiler need to change when adding a heat pump?

Is it worth it?
John Siegenthaler 200x200 author headshot on a white background.
John Siegenthaler, P.E.
March 1, 2024

There is a growing interest in adding air-to-water heat pumps to existing hydronic heating systems. While I support their use, I do not recommend replacing a perfectly good cast-iron boiler that still has a long service life.
